Output 38f3f14885d897242708cf79b4ea77c507636b7821d63896020ec50a1a95e890:1

value
6951497319705
script pubkey
OP_0 OP_PUSHBYTES_20 8dfc154ed94834ea69ed46b6bb45c7cfe97e82f6
address
tb1q3h7p2nkefq6w560dg6mtk3w8el5haqhkw2wxyz
transaction
38f3f14885d897242708cf79b4ea77c507636b7821d63896020ec50a1a95e890
confirmations
185013
spent
true